    Introduction

    In today’s competitive job market, securing an internship is a crucial step for students and recent graduates in Indonesia. An internship letter, often referred to as an internship application letter or request letter, is a formal document that highlights your skills, education, and enthusiasm for a particular role. This guide provides 25+ sample internship letters tailored to the Indonesian job market in 2026, offering strategies and templates to help you stand out.

    These sample letters are designed to demonstrate effective strategies for applying to internships in Indonesia. Each letter is formatted professionally and includes key elements such as a strong opening, clear expression of interest, and a compelling closing. Use these examples to craft your own internship application letters and increase your chances of securing the opportunity you desire.

    Before diving into the samples, it’s important to understand the key components of an effective internship letter. These include a professional tone, clear expression of your qualifications, and a demonstration of your enthusiasm for the role and the company. The following examples will show you how to incorporate these elements into your own letters.

    1. Internship Application for Marketing Position

    John Doe
    Jl. Sudirman No. 123
    Jakarta, Indonesia

    15 April 2026

    Dear Hiring Manager,

    I am writing to express my interest in the marketing internship position at PT. Indonesia Global. With a strong academic background in marketing and hands-on experience in digital campaigns, I am confident in my ability to contribute to your team.

    I have successfully managed social media campaigns for a local business, increasing their online presence by 30%. I am eager to bring my skills and enthusiasm to your company.

    Thank you for considering my application. I look forward to the opportunity to discuss how I can contribute to PT. Indonesia Global.

    Sincerely,
    John Doe

    2. Follow-Up Letter After Internship Application

    Jane Smith
    Jl. Menteng No. 45
    Jakarta, Indonesia

    20 April 2026

    Dear Hiring Manager,

    I am writing to follow up on my internship application for the marketing position at PT. Indonesia Global, which I submitted on 10 April 2026. I understand that hiring processes can take time, but I wanted to express my continued interest in the opportunity.

    I would be more than happy to provide any additional information or documents that may assist in the selection process. Please do not hesitate to contact me at (021) 1234 5678.

    Thank you for your time and consideration.

    Sincerely,
    Jane Smith

    3. Internship Application for Engineering Position

    Michael Johnson
    Jl. Thamrin No. 78
    Jakarta, Indonesia

    25 April 2026

    Dear Hiring Manager,

    I am writing to apply for the engineering internship position at PT. Indonesia Engineering Solutions. With a strong academic background in mechanical engineering and hands-on experience in project management, I am confident in my ability to contribute to your team.

    I have successfully led a team of five in a university project, completing the task ahead of schedule and within budget. I am eager to bring my skills and enthusiasm to your company.

    Thank you for considering my application. I look forward to the opportunity to discuss how I can contribute to PT. Indonesia Engineering Solutions.

    Sincerely,
    Michael Johnson
